Abstract
In order to understand the temporal and spatial distribution of rhizopoda(amoebae and heliozoa) in Masan Bay, we collected samples seasonally at 33 stations during April 2006-February 2007. Heliozoa occurred in all seasons during this study and the abundance was in the range of 0~8.4x103 cells/L (mean 0.82x103 cells/L). Amoebae occurred in winter season only and the abundance was in the range of 0~175.4x103 cells/L (mean 14.0x103 cells/L). The abundance of heliozoa was negatively correlated with DO and pH. While the abundance of amoebae had positive correlations with DO and COD, and had also a significant relationship with chl-a concentrations. This study suggests that in Masan Bay the dissolved oxygen to be an important factor for determining the abundances of heliozoan and amoebae, and the chl-a concentrations to be a potentially important factor determining the abundance of amoebae.
